CLS Catering Services is a joint venture of Cathay Pacific Airways Ltd. and LSG Sky Chefs, the world’s largest airline caterer and provider of integrated service solutions. CLS operates from both Toronto and Vancouver airports and has been an industry leader in Canada for over 20 years.

What We Do
CLS Catering Services Ltd. is a joint venture between LSG Sky Chefs and Cathay Pacific Airways Ltd., specializing in airline catering and integrated service solutions. Their offerings include in-flight catering, buy-on-board services, equipment logistics, consulting, and lounge services. Operating primarily at Vancouver, Calgary, and Toronto airports, the company has also successfully expanded its expertise into the retail and train services sectors.
